Celtics Pierce Named East Player Of The Week

BOSTON (CBS) - Celtics captain Paul Pierce has been named the NBA's Eastern Conference Player of the Week.

Pierce led the Celtics to a 4-0 week, averaging 21.8 points per game while shooting 59-percent from the field.

Pierce recorded a double-double in the Celtics 115-103 win over the Phoenix Suns, scoring 16 points and grabbing 13 rebounds. He followed that up by scoring 27-points in the team's 107-103 win over the Golden State Warriors Friday night.

This is the third time a Celtic has been named Player of the Week this season. Rajon Rondo took home the honors the first week of the season, and Pierce won back in December.
